    Can I access the Microsoft/Xbox Cloud to re-download deleted Minecraft Worlds?

    Hello, I'm Felipe and I'm an independent Community Advisor, and I'll do my best to help you.

    It's possible that your deleted Minecraft world is still available in the Xbox Cloud. Here's what you can try to recover it:

    On your Xbox Series S, open the Minecraft game and go to the "Play" menu.

    Look for the "Sync Old Worlds" option and select it.

    This should show you a list of worlds that are stored in the Xbox Cloud. Look for your deleted world and select it.

    Choose the "Download" option to download the world back to your Xbox Series S.

    If your world is not showing up in the Sync Old Worlds list, it may have been permanently deleted from the Xbox Cloud as well. In that case, you may not be able to recover it.

    Regarding your Seagate storage expansion, if you had previously saved a backup of your Minecraft world on the expansion before deleting it, you might be able to recover it from there. You can connect the Seagate expansion to your Xbox Series S and then try to locate the saved data for the deleted world.

    If none of these methods work, unfortunately, it may not be possible to recover your deleted Minecraft world. It's always a good idea to make regular backups of your saved data to prevent permanent loss of your game progress.
